Introduction to Ratios
We’ll start with the basics by defining what a ratio is. A ratio is a way to compare two or more quantities. We’ll explain how ratios can be represented in different forms: as fractions, with a colon, or using the word "to."
Examples will be provided to illustrate how ratios are used in everyday life, from recipes and mixtures to scaling and more.
Types of Ratios
Part-to-Part Ratios: Compare one part of a whole to another part of the same whole. For example, if you have a basket with 3 apples and 2 oranges, the ratio of apples to oranges is 3:2.
Part-to-Whole Ratios: Compare one part of a whole to the whole itself. Using the same basket example, if there are 5 fruits in total, the ratio of apples to the total number of fruits is 3:5.
Equivalent Ratios: Learn how to identify and create equivalent ratios. We’ll cover how to simplify ratios and scale them up or down while maintaining their equivalency.
Introduction to Proportions
A proportion is an equation that states that two ratios are equivalent. We’ll define proportions and show how to write them. For example, if the ratio of boys to girls in a class is 3:4 and there are 12 boys, we can find out the number of girls using proportions.
We’ll explore how to solve proportions using cross-multiplication, a powerful method that helps find unknown values.
Solving Proportions
We’ll go through various methods to solve proportions, including the cross-multiplication technique, which involves multiplying the numerator of one ratio by the denominator of the other ratio and setting the products equal to each other.
